Home
last modified time | relevance | path

Searched refs:contextFetcher (Results 1 – 1 of 1) sorted by relevance

/haiku/src/system/kernel/locks/
H A Duser_mutex.cpp522 UserMutexContextFetcher contextFetcher(mutex, flags); in user_mutex_lock() local
523 if (contextFetcher.InitCheck() != B_OK) in user_mutex_lock()
524 return contextFetcher.InitCheck(); in user_mutex_lock()
527 UserMutexEntry* entry = get_user_mutex_entry(contextFetcher.Context(), in user_mutex_lock()
528 contextFetcher.Address()); in user_mutex_lock()
535 flags, timeout, entryLocker, contextFetcher.IsWired()); in user_mutex_lock()
537 put_user_mutex_entry(contextFetcher.Context(), entry); in user_mutex_lock()
616 UserMutexContextFetcher contextFetcher(mutex, flags); in _user_mutex_unblock() local
617 if (contextFetcher.InitCheck() != B_OK) in _user_mutex_unblock()
618 return contextFetcher.InitCheck(); in _user_mutex_unblock()
[all …]